C. Kladis et al., FT-IR studies of the NO adsorption on rare earth (Eu/Gd/Tb) exchanged new generation silicoaluminophosphate catalysts of chabazite type, CATAL TODAY, 63(2-4), 2000, pp. 297-303
Novel rare earth exchanged silicoaluminophosphate catalysts (small pore, 0.
43 nm) of chabazite type have been prepared. The rare earth elements europi
um (Eu), gadolinium (Gd) and terbium (Tb) were used for preparing the catio
n exchanged chabazite type SAPO-18 catalysts. Routine and sophisticated ins
trumental techniques were used for the material characterisation, The FT-IR
technique was used to study the in situ interaction of NO on the rare eart
h exchanged SAPO-18 catalysts. The adsorption of NO on the Eu-, Gd-, Tb-exc
hanged SAPO-18 samples led to the formation of nitrous oxide, mono- and din
itrosyl complexes of Eu, Gd and Tb, nitrogen dioxide and nitrate species. (
